Aluminum spreading plays a necessary role in numerous industries because of its versatility and desirable buildings. This technique is extensively made use of in vehicle manufacturing, where lightweight parts enhance fuel performance and overall efficiency. Aluminum castings are employed for engine blocks, cylinder heads, and transmission housings, supplying toughness while decreasing weight. In aerospace, light weight aluminum's favorable strength-to-weight ratio makes it suitable for aircraft parts, adding to fuel cost savings and boosted trip dynamics.




Additionally, the construction industry benefits from aluminum spreadings in structural components and architectural elements, using sturdiness and resistance to corrosion. Customer goods, such as pots and pans and devices, also make use of light weight aluminum castings for their warm conductivity and aesthetic charm. The electronics sector relies upon aluminum for real estates and heat sinks, making sure reliable thermal monitoring. In general, aluminum spreading's versatility enables it to satisfy diverse industry needs effectively, solidifying its importance in modern-day production methods.


Trick Manufacturing Techniques in Aluminum Shop



In the domain of light weight aluminum shop operations, numerous manufacturing methods play an essential role in forming the end products that serve diverse industries. Aluminum Casting. Trick techniques include sand spreading, pass away spreading, and financial investment spreading, each offering distinct benefits based on the application demands


Sand spreading uses a mix of sand and binder to develop molds, permitting complex geometries at reduced costs. Pass away casting, on the various other hand, utilizes high-pressure injection of liquified aluminum right into steel molds, making sure precision and a smooth surface area finish, perfect for high-volume production. Investment casting supplies exceptional dimensional precision and surface high quality, making it ideal for complex layouts.


Additionally, strategies such as long-term mold casting and gravity pass away casting further improve the flexibility of light weight aluminum foundry procedures (Casting Foundry). Each method is chosen based on aspects like manufacturing quantity, part complexity, and product buildings, guaranteeing desirable outcomes across numerous applications


Thawing Processes and Temperature Control



Reliable melting processes and exact temperature level control are fundamental for achieving perfect aluminum shop procedures. The melting of light weight aluminum generally includes various methods, including crucible melting, induction melting, and rotary melting, each with its own benefits and applications. Crucible melting is generally used for small batches, while induction melting provides efficient home heating and consistent temperature level distribution.

Temperature level control is important in these processes to ensure the light weight aluminum reaches its needed melting factor, which is web link around 660 degrees Celsius. Preserving this temperature stops oxidation and contamination, which can detrimentally influence the steel's buildings. Advanced temperature level surveillance systems, such as thermocouples and pyrometers, are commonly utilized to give real-time information. Correct temperature administration not only boosts the top quality of the thawed aluminum but also boosts power performance and minimizes operational costs, making it a vital element of aluminum shop procedures.


Molding Techniques for Accuracy Castings



Understanding molding techniques is crucial for generating precision spreadings in aluminum shop procedures. Various approaches, such as sand, financial investment, and die casting, play a critical duty in achieving wanted tolerances and surface area look at this website finishes. Sand spreading, for instance, makes use of a combination of sand and binder to create mold and mildews, permitting detailed layouts and huge elements. Investment spreading, on the other hand, uses wax patterns that are coated in ceramic material, leading to highly described and precise forms. Pass away casting utilizes high-pressure injection of molten light weight aluminum into metal mold and mildews, making certain constant measurements and rapid manufacturing prices.


Each technique has its advantages and is selected based upon elements such as intricacy, volume, and mechanical residential or commercial properties needed. Effective mold style, consisting of venting and gating systems, additionally boosts the quality and accuracy of the ended up item. Comprehending these molding strategies enables foundries to satisfy details sector needs and improve general functional performance.


Ending Up Processes to Improve Aluminum Elements



Completing processes play an essential duty in enhancing the performance and aesthetic appeals of light weight aluminum components. These processes, which follow casting, aim to boost surface high quality, corrosion resistance, and mechanical residential or commercial properties. Typical techniques consist of machining, which improves measurements and surface area coating, and polishing, which boosts visual appeal by creating a smooth, reflective surface area.


Plating is one more significant procedure, supplying a sturdy oxide layer that shields versus wear and deterioration while permitting color personalization. Additionally, powder finish provides a large array of surfaces and colors, making certain both defense and visual improvement.


Sometimes, elements might undertake shot blowing up to eliminate impurities and boost bond for subsequent coverings (aluminum casting company). Generally, these completing processes are crucial for maximizing the capability and life expectancy of aluminum elements, making them appropriate for diverse applications throughout various industries
